Today we’d like to introduce you to Melody Hsieh-Hornstra.
Thanks for sharing your story with us Melody. So, let’s start at the beginning, and we can move on from there.
I came to America as a young teenager who knew only a dozen or so English words. I began my first company in 2000 with family money and sold scooters, but after six years, sales plummeted, and I decided to return to school.
After obtaining my MBA at USC’s Marshall School of Business, I re-launched Asa Products in late 2006 with a brand new product line – Mobo Cruisers – a line of three-wheeled cruisers for kids and adults. This time I applied what I learned in school about marketing, operations, and research before I launched the brand.
Today, Mobo Cruisers is sold online and at various retail stores in the US and has expanded into Canada. Since the company started, the company has experienced a great amount of sales increase, and I’ve been able to successfully broker licensing deals with companies such as Disney.
Overall, has it been relatively smooth? If not, what were some of the struggles along the way?
It has not been a smooth road. When I launched my first company in 2000, it was an incredible success, but I did not have a long term plan, nor was I concentrated on building a brand. Ultimately I closed that business, went back to school and reapplied what I learned and launched Mobo Cruisers. This time I developed a solid business plan with long term goals and business has been solid for more than a decade.
